Glass & Mirror Contractor - Villas, NJ
Average rating
4.33
4.3
Average rating
Cam-den Glass Of Villas, located in Villas, is a glass company. They provide glass installation and glass flooring as well as other services.
Average rating
Address
Delaware Ave Tampa Ave
Villas, NJ 08251